Any Tatula 6'10" M-XF spinning rod users?

Featured Replies

  • Super User

Finding reviews on this rod is like looking for hen's teeth.  :(  Haven't been using spinning gear for some time, but looking to downsize lures locally in hopes of actually catching a few fish.  Considered the 7'1" MLF as ratings are nearly identical, but am assuming the M-XF should have a bit more power while the tip is fully capable of handling the same weight lures.  Probably be trying a wide variety of lures, but looking to start with small finesse worms.

 

As an aside, I am looking to move to Florida so I figured that was another good reason to go Medium power over a ML.
